The 2023 ZF Chassis Systems strike was a targeted labor strike carried out by 190 workers at ZF Chassis Systems organized under the United Auto Workers Local No. 2083 in Tuscaloosa. The walk-out began on September 20, 2023. The action was separate from the national strike by UAW workers at the United States' three major automakers.
ZF Chassis Systems furnished axle assemblies to Mercedes-Benz US International in Vance. The striking workers demanded an end to the company's tiered wage system and a reduction in healthcare costs. They rejected four contract proposals from ZF which did not satisfy those demands.
University of Alabama College Democrats joined striking workers on the picket line on October 2.
